CHECKREIN
Check"rein`, n.

1. A short rein looped over the check hook to prevent a horse from lowering his head; — called also a bearing rein.

2. A branch rein connecting the driving rein of one horse of a span or pair with the bit of the other horse.

CHECKROLL
Check"roll`, n.

Defn: A list of servants in a household; — called also chequer roll.

CHECKSTRING
Check"string`, n.

Defn: A cord by which a person in a carriage or horse car may signal to the driver.
